Distinctive features of turquoise color in the interior of the kitchen
Cool aqua will look great in the kitchen if it is well lit by the sun and faces south. Even in direct sunlight, the soft tint will create the illusion of coolness. If the room is located on the north side, then the cold color should be carefully applied inside.
It should also be borne in mind that the turquoise tone changes properties depending on the lighting. Therefore, with a dark base finish, it can look strict, reducing appetite and forming a gloomy atmosphere.When using a tiffany shade in a design, it is recommended to use LED lighting to reveal its beauty. You can increase the vibrancy of turquoise when combined with other harmonious or contrasting colors.
Features of the selection of a kitchen set
The set, fully or partially painted in turquoise, is ideal for rooms with a single-tone finish. The fronts of the cabinets can be made in a glossy or matte finish, depending on the free space. Gloss visually expands the room, while matte finish has the opposite effect. Details like open shelving and glass doors add a sense of space.
Successful combinations
The combination of different colors in the interior of the kitchen opens up possibilities for transforming the room, taking into account all wishes.
Using successful combinations of shades, it will be possible to visually expand or reduce the space, hide flaws and create a harmonious atmosphere.
with white
The most common and effective is the combination of a bright turquoise tone with a white finish. Snow white is considered versatile and goes well with other shades. The finished interior symbolizes endless spaces, creating a sense of serenity.
with beige
Beige tones can be used to decorate any surface in the room in combination with bright furniture. The reverse combination will also work. Beige finish with artificial aging of the surface can be supplemented with decorative items and wooden furniture with original inserts.
Gray
Adding gray creates a subdued effect, so it should be used as a backdrop for bright furniture or decorative items.The combination of gray and turquoise turns out to be light and pleasant, but in order for the interior not to be too cold, you need to dilute the gamut with white or make bright accents on individual elements.
with brown
The rich brown color helps to emphasize the bright facades of the kitchen set, made in turquoise tones. MDF frame fronts in chocolate color with veneer trim will look great. As an addition to such an interior, it is recommended to use individual white elements to dilute the saturation, add light and visually expand the room.
With light wood
In the decoration, you can use light wood tones and warmer variations. Both options are considered a good pair for a combination and help to give warmth to the interior, make it expressive and textured.
orange
It is better to use orange for accents. A bright color will suit an apron, textiles and wallpaper on one of the walls. It is recommended to combine warm orange tones with cold turquoise in order to play up the contrast.
With other colors
In addition to the basic combinations, there are many other options that also find application in the interior. When using them, there are several nuances and recommendations that you should get acquainted with when drawing up a design project. Other colors that can be combined with turquoise are:
- Black. The combination is too contrasting, so black is more suitable for accents. Dark shades are appropriate on the worktop and the glass surface of the apron.
- Red purple. Due to their high luminosity, these colors can only be used indoors in small quantities. Otherwise, the design will turn out to be too colorful.
- Blue.Decorating the kitchen in turquoise tones with the addition of shades of blue looks harmonious, but it may look too cold. To create a harmonious atmosphere, it is recommended to dilute the monochrome ensemble with light accents.
Sleek Design Features
The design of the kitchen can be made following one of the standard instructions. Each style has individual features and characteristics.
Modern
The Art Nouveau style is distinguished by its rigor and functionality, therefore, following this style, it is important to avoid excesses and negligence in design. Worktops, cabinet fronts and dining room furniture should be made in the same colors and have smooth surfaces. The following materials are used for decoration:
- tinted glass;
- bright coated steel;
- smooth wood;
- artificial stone with a brilliant shine.
If the kitchen set is turquoise in color, then it needs to be given a mirror shine. It is better to use achromatic colors as the color for the background and additional elements.
Minimalism
While adhering to minimalism, you need to consider a number of basic principles. Stylistics assumes the following:
- a minimum of decorative objects and the absence of non-functional furniture;
- geometric shapes and simplicity;
- the use of no more than three colors in the interior, which are usually used as neutral base tones;
- built-in household appliances;
- bright lighting.
Advanced technology
Characteristic of the hi-tech style are the rounded corners and flowing lines, as well as the glossy fronts of the headphones. When decorating a high-tech room, turquoise tones are needed to add brightness.A kitchen apron can be decorated with a photo print with themed images. As a background for the headset, a good solution would be white walls, a gray floor and a glossy stretch ceiling.
Classic
The classic interior of the kitchen is characterized by elevation and a certain coldness. Observing the classical orientation, it is recommended to use geometric patterns and ornaments on the surfaces of walls and furniture. The overall image can be supplemented with golden or bronze door handles and other decorative elements.
Provence
The French direction with the name Provence is defined using a pastel blue color. Most often, the surface of wooden furniture is made in this shade. The walls, patterns on an apron and patterns on textiles can also be turquoise. You can complement the design in the style of Provence with a natural range, including the color of clarified wood, lime or terracotta.
Country
The country decoration requires the use of certain materials. To create an atmosphere, it is recommended to choose natural or artificial stone as a floor covering. Ceramic tiles with a matte finish in neutral tones are also a good option. A country-style kitchen set is made of wood or creates an imitation of it. It is important that the cabinets look solid and visually sound. Pastel colors are used as the basic range.
Mediterranean
In the Mediterranean style, pronounced derivatives of turquoise prevail. The rich coloring opens up possibilities for full use of color in the interior. When arranging the kitchen, curtains, upholstered furniture and decor items of different colors are used.
Use accents
Properly placed accents are an important detail of any interior. You can focus on individual elements, painting in a suitable shade.
Apron
A protective apron is made to match the turquoise helmet, leaving a plain background or adding patterns. The coating can be made of impact-resistant glass, plastic or small ceramic tiles. Another stylish option would be masonry in a beige tone.
Walls
If you want to decorate the walls in tiffany color, it is better to paint or glue on one side only with wallpaper of this color. You can also make light inserts to match the faceplates of the helmet.
table top
Traditionally, worktops are made in neutral shades of white, gray and beige. To add originality to the interior, you can use the textures of natural wood, steel and granite.
Ceiling
Common options for finishing the kitchen ceiling in turquoise colors are white paint or installing a PVC film. Subject to the Provencal style, it is allowed to decorate with beams.
Curtains and decor
For the kitchen in turquoise tones, it is better to choose Roman blinds made of translucent fabric. When arranging decorative items, it is important that their color matches the range and overall style.
